Adagene Inc. (ADAG) Who Invests in Adagene Inc. (ADAG) and Why?

Understanding the investor profile of Adagene Inc. (ADAG) involves examining the various types of investors, their motivations, and the strategies they employ. This provides valuable insights into the market's perception of the company.

Key Investor Types:

The investor base of Adagene Inc. (ADAG) can be categorized into several key types:

  • Institutional Investors: These include investment companies, hedge funds, pension funds, and insurance companies. Institutional investors often hold a significant portion of a company's shares and can significantly influence its stock price.
  • Retail Investors: These are individual investors who buy and sell securities for their own accounts. Their impact on the stock price can be substantial, especially when trading activity is high.
  • Corporate Insiders: These are the company's executives and board members. Their transactions can provide insights into the company's internal perspective.

Investment Motivations:

Investors are drawn to Adagene Inc. (ADAG) for various reasons, primarily revolving around the company's potential for growth and its position in the biopharmaceutical industry.

  • Growth Prospects: Investors may be attracted to Adagene Inc. (ADAG)'s growth prospects, particularly its pipeline of novel antibody-based cancer immunotherapies. Positive clinical trial results and potential regulatory approvals can drive investor interest.
  • Market Position: The company's strategic collaborations and partnerships with other pharmaceutical companies can enhance its market position and attract investors seeking exposure to innovative therapies.
  • Financial Metrics: Key financial metrics, such as revenue growth, cash runway, and R&D expenditure efficiency, play a crucial role in investor decision-making.

Investment Strategies:

Different investors adopt various strategies when investing in Adagene Inc. (ADAG), depending on their investment horizon and risk tolerance.

  • Long-Term Holding: Some investors may adopt a long-term holding strategy, focusing on the company's potential for sustained growth over several years. This strategy is often favored by institutional investors and those who believe in the company's long-term vision.
  • Short-Term Trading: Short-term traders aim to capitalize on short-term price fluctuations. News events, clinical trial updates, and market sentiment can influence their trading decisions.
  • Value Investing: Value investors seek to identify undervalued companies with the expectation that the market will eventually recognize their intrinsic value. These investors often focus on fundamental analysis and financial metrics.

Adagene Inc. (ADAG) Key Investors and Their Impact on Adagene Inc. (ADAG)

Understanding the investor profile of Adagene Inc. (ADAG) is crucial for assessing the company's stability, growth potential, and strategic direction. Key investors can significantly influence a company's decisions and stock performance through their holdings and actions.

While specific, real-time major shareholder data and recent moves can fluctuate and are best obtained from up-to-date financial news sources and SEC filings, we can discuss the general types of investors and their potential impact. Institutional investors, venture capital firms, and strategic partners often play significant roles in biotech companies like Adagene Inc. (ADAG).

Here are potential types of investors and their possible influence:

  • Institutional Investors: These include mutual funds, pension funds, and hedge funds. Large institutional holdings can provide stability to the stock and influence corporate governance.
  • Venture Capital Firms: These firms often invest early in biotech companies, providing crucial funding for research and development. Their expertise and network can also help guide the company's strategy.
  • Strategic Partners: Pharmaceutical companies or other industry players may invest in Adagene Inc. (ADAG) to gain access to its technology or collaborate on drug development. These partnerships can provide financial resources and validation of the company's platform.
  • Individual Investors: High-net-worth individuals with an interest in the biotechnology sector may also hold significant stakes.

Investor influence can manifest in several ways:

  • Voting Rights: Large shareholders have a greater say in company decisions, such as electing board members and approving major transactions.
  • Activism: Activist investors may push for changes in company strategy, operations, or management to increase shareholder value.
  • Market Sentiment: Significant buying or selling activity by key investors can impact market sentiment and stock price.

Recent moves by major investors, such as increasing or decreasing their positions, can signal their confidence in the company's prospects or concerns about its performance. Monitoring these moves can provide valuable insights into the company's outlook.
